Rational Developer for i Packaging
Rational Developer for i is available in three editions:
- RPG and COBOL Tools For developing basic compiled language applications that run on the IBM i operating system (Note: This edition also supports C, C++, CL, DDS, and SQL development).
- RPG and COBOL + Modernization Tools, Java Edition Supplements the RPG and COBOL Tools with a rich Java, Web, SOA, and mobile development environment to support extension and modernization of heritage IBM i applications.
- RPG and COBOL + Modernization Tools, EGL Edition Supplements the RPG and COBOL Tools with the complete Rational Business Developer product to support extension and modernization of heritage IBM i applications using the EGL language.
Rational Developer for i runs on developers' desktops and is integrated with the server-side optimizing IBM i compilers, as well as with server-side explorer and debugger services. It can also support many development activities while not connected to a server.
Among the key capabilities provided by V9.0 of Rational Developer for i that continue to be provided in V9.1:
- Remote System Explorer for connecting to IBM i servers, searching and managing server-side files, and running server scripts
- Language-aware editors and refactoring agents
- Debuggers (including server-side agents)
- Application analysis tools
- In the RPG and COBOL + Modernization Tools, Java Edition: a substantial subset of the IBM Rational Application Developer for WebSphere Software
- offering to support Java, JEE, Web, and SOA development
- In the RPG and COBOL + Modernization Tools, EGL Edition: the complete IBM Rational Business Developer offering
- In the RPG and COBOL + Modernization Tools, Java Edition: inclusion of IBM Worklight Developer Edition to support development of hybrid mobile applications that exploit the capabilities of the Worklight runtimes and connect to systems of record implemented in RPG, COBOL, C/C++, SQL, or Java/JEE running on AIX or Linux on Power® servers
- Inclusion of IBM Data Studio
Rational Developer for i new capabilities in V9.1
- Line level code coverage analysis capability. Code coverage can be launched on any program or service program that can be debugged. The developer can then see by views, html reports, and editor annotations exactly which lines of the programs have been execute or not executed by that particular scenario. This can provide a great benefit in measuring the effectiveness of automated or manual tests. It can help focus additional testing on code paths that have not been executed. It can aid the reduction of the amount of testing required by eliminating tests that are duplicate in terms of which code paths they exercise.
- Enhancements to the basic development tools (such as editor, outline view, and debugger) to support the expanded scope of RPG free-form syntax (H, F, D, and P statements) that is now supported by the ILE RPG compiler. (The compiler is sold separately as Rational Development Studio for i. The new support for full free-form syntax was introduced in a technical refresh of that product delivered in the fourth quarter of 2013). Details:
- Rational Developer for i 9.1 now fully supports and exploits the new language capabilities with prompting, syntax checking, program verifiers, source styling logic, live outline views, content assist, hover hints, and more.
- Wizards such as the D-Specs Wizard, Procedure Wizard and Java Method Call Wizard can now generate free-form definitions into the correct location of mixed free-form and fixed-form RPG source.
- In free-form definitions and calculation statements: new token-specific help for all keywords and built-in functions. Hitting F1 on ILE RPG keywords and built-in functions in free-form control and declaration statements will bring up the section of the RPG reference manual specific to that keyword or built-in functions. This can help developers to learn the new free-form syntax and provide in-context assistance for much of the richness of RPG function found in keywords and built-in functions.
- Support for enhancements to RPG and CL that will be delivered with the next release of the compilers. For example:
- RPG: CCSID support for handling multiple encodings with confidence.
- RPG: XML-INTO options.
- RPG: performance improvement for date and time functions by eliminating the validation step.
- RPG: timestamp precision is now configurable.
- RPG outline view enhancement: the outline can now be quickly subset to the language elements of interest by specifying a filter. This was one of the highest voted RFEs as customers find the cross-reference information in the outline view invaluable, but find it difficult to find that information among the hundreds of fields in the names space of a large RPG module. The ability to quickly filter to the variable or procedure of interest and see all references can be a boon to their productivity.
- Remote System Explorer (RSE) enhancement: member filters can now subset based upon the 50 character description.
- In the RPG and COBOL + Modernization Tools, Java Edition: support for the latest version of the WebSphere Application Server Liberty profile.
- In the RPG and COBOL + Modernization Tools, Java Edition: enhancements for developing hybrid mobile application front ends using the open source Cordova framework and command line interface tools.
Rational Developer for i Deprecations
These capabilities are declared to be deprecated and they might be removed from the products in some future release. Clients who believe they would be adversely impacted by future removal of these capabilities should inform Rational Client Support, so that their feedback can be considered in future product planning.
- All the three editions: Rational ClearCase® SCM Adapter
- RPG and COBOL + Modernization Tools, Java Edition:
- Java Visual Editor
- tool support for EJB 1.x and 2.x
- tool support for JSF Widget Library
Rational Developer for i removals
These capabilities were previously declared to be deprecated and as of V9.1 they have been removed from the product.
- (In Java edition) Rational Unified Process (RUP) Process Advisor and Process Browser
- (In Java edition) Rational RequisitePro® Integration
- (In Java edition) Rational Cloud Toolkit (for Smart Cloud Enterprise, which has been retired and replaced by SoftLayer)
- (In EGL edition) Jasper Support (deprecated at 9.0, BIRT is the recommended alternative)
- (In EGL edition) Portal support (deprecated at 9.0, RUI support is the recommended alternative)

Rational Developer for AIX and Linux New capabilities in V9.1
These are the key new capabilities introduced in Rational Developer for AIX and Linux, V9.1:
- Usability improvements for multi-context development: V9.1 streamlines the workflow when developing on multiple servers or platforms. Switching to new contexts is easier and more intuitive, with a new feedback and preferences. This helps reduce development time when porting or developing and maintaining applications with more than one target platform.
- "Headless" command-line data collection for Performance Advisor: new command-line tools let you now collect the same Performance Advisor activity data that you could previously obtain when interacting with Performance Advisor in your Eclipse workbench, but do so in an automatable "headless" (no GUI) mode and then import the results into the workbench. This adds value by enabling automated collection of performance data, and by improving support for complex applications. For example the data collection can now be integrated with nightly builds and test runs to make performance data available to developers on a regular basis. Rational Developer for AIX and Linux also supports complex application launches better than the default Eclipse launch mechanism, such as when you need to launch multiprocess applications from custom scripts. The tools are easy to set up and integrate into your normal launch scenario. They support flexible configuration of options, and support all of the features that are available in the interactive collection mode.
- Groups in Performance Advisor Hotspots browser: the Performance Advisor's "Hotspots browser" control now supports user-controlled groups of processes and threads. The default groups provided by Performance Advisor can be changed, and new groups added. Performance results can be displayed for groups or for the individual items in the group. This flexible grouping improves the usability of the Hotspots browser, particularly with large multiprocess or multithreaded applications, by letting the user organize the results in a way that is meaningful to the application structure so that developers can better interpret them.

Software requirements
Rational Developer for i, V9.1
Server (to which the IDE is connected):
- Supported IBM i operating system versions: 6.1, 7.1, 7.2
- More information about any required Power Systems server PTFs can be found by:
- Opening the Remote System Explorer perspective if it is not already open. The name of the current perspective is shown in the top left corner of the title bar for the Window. To open the Remote Systems Explorer perspective, select Window > Open Perspective > Other and select Remote System Explorer from the list.
- Creating a connection to your IBM i by expanding New Connection and double-clicking on IBM i.
- Expanding your new connection and right-click on IBM i Objects.
- Selecting Verify Connection from the menu. This displays a dialog that shows which required PTFs are already installed on the system and which ones are missing.
- IBM i is needed only if the programming objects are located on the IBM i or the applications contain backend code on the IBM i.
- Compiling RPG, COBOL, C, C++, CL, or DDS on IBM i using the Remote System Explorer (RSE), the compilers must be installed.
